Abstract
Method for determining the rotational position of a rotor (9) in a permanent magnet synchronous machine (7), wherein the stator (8) comprises windings (11 - 16) for a first, second and third phase (17, 18, 19), comprising the steps:- applying a first voltage pulse (29) to the first phase (17),- determining respective first measures for the current (30, 31) induced by the first voltage pulse (29) in the second and third phase (18, 19),- selecting a first selected phase depending on the first measures for the current (30, 31), wherein the first selected phase is either the second or the third phase (18, 19),- applying a second voltage pulse (40) to the first selected phase,- determining respective second measures for the current (33, 34) induced by the second voltage pulse (40) in the phases (17, 18, 19) of the stator (8) that are not the first selected phase, and- determining the rotational position of the rotor (9) depending on the second measures of the current (33, 34).
